Magpie Well
Magpie Well is a spring in Constable Burton, Richmondshire District, England. Magpie Well is situated nearby to the forest The Leases, as well as near Boys Plantation.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Middleham Castle
Middleham Castle is a ruined castle in Middleham in Wensleydale, in the county of North Yorkshire, England. It was built by Robert Fitzrandolph, 3rd Lord of Middleham and Spennithorne, commencing in 1190. Middleham Castle is situated 2 miles southwest of Magpie Well.Church of St Michael

Leyburn railway station
Railway station
Photo: Paul Allison,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Leyburn railway station is on the Wensleydale Railway, a seasonal, heritage service and serves the town of Leyburn in North Yorkshire, England. During the summer months it is served by at least three trains per day; at other times of the year the service is mainly at weekends and public holidays. Leyburn railway station is situated 2 miles west of Magpie Well.

Barden is a hamlet and civil parish in North Yorkshire, England. It is about 5 miles south of Richmond. According to the 2001 census the parish had a population of 49, remaining at less than 100 in the 2011 Census. Barden is situated 2 miles north of Magpie Well.
Middleham
Town
Photo: Joe Regan,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Middleham is a market town and civil parish in the district and county of North Yorkshire, England. It lies in Wensleydale in the Yorkshire Dales, on the south side of the valley, upstream from the confluence of the River Ure and River Cover. Middleham is situated 2 miles southwest of Magpie Well.
